We have an exciting new opportunity for a Project Manager from an infrastructure and electrical project delivery background.

What Do We Need

  • Proven experience of managing electrical/electromechanical projects from design through to completion.
  • Knowledge of specialised electrical systems and evidence of their installation.
  • Sound commercial knowledge and understanding of the cost and value of packages as well as delivery experience, should be able to question and challenge CE’s.
  • Hands on experience of managing delivery using NEC4 contracts including management of change and stakeholder management.

Qualifications

  • NEC4 Project Manager Accreditation.
  • Membership of relevant professional body.
  • Degree qualified in Electrical and Electronic Engineering.

Location

The role is Hybrid where 3 days per week will either be spent at the office in Glasgow City Centre or at the Client site near Helensburgh.

Security Requirements

SC Clearance

Due to the secure nature of this project, restrictions in relation to UK residency and nationality will apply.
